Wanted VIPs to unlock sports facilities

Two AMC-built swimming pools worth crores lie shut for want of suitable ‘inaugurators’; gym locked up as civic body can’t find a good trainer

The city does not boast of too many sports facilities. And those built recently have been left to languish for want of the right dignitary to inaugurate it. A swimming pool built by AUDA for Rs 2 crore, now taken over by AMC and the pool at Staduim crossroad renovated and refurbished at the cost of Rs 5.5 crore remained closed awaiting inauguration.
There’s more. A gym built in Nava Vada, complete with modern equipment and as good as any private facility, is lying unused because the AMC can’t find a suitable trainer. A municipal school no. 17-18, a beautiful structure now after the renovation, is locked for the last year-and-a-half for AMC hasn’t inaugurated it. ‘For want of a shoe, the horse was lost, for want of a VIP, some necessary fun was lost....’ the well-known lines could go.
